[Objective] To investigate the influence of three vaccine combinations of CSF,HP-PRRS and FMD on immune response and expression of some cytokines in swine serum. [Methods] The dynamic change of IL-1,IL-2 and IFN-γ expression in swine serum were tested by ELISA. The dynamic change rule of the three kinds of cytokines after immunization were analyzed. [Results] The change trends of IL-1,IL-2 and IFN–γ content in swine serum after immunization were not the same. A “wave”trend was appeared in the expression of IL-1,and there was no significant difference between different groups. IL-2 change trend was not consistent with different groups,combined with the group immunized by CSF,HP–PRRS and FMD vaccine,compared with the control group(group C). The expression of IL-2 was significantly different at 60 d and 90 d after second immunization;Compared with group C,the expression of IFN–γ in the group immunized by CSF,HP–PRRS and FMD vaccine was increasing. Expressions of IFN –γ were significantly different at each time point(P <0.05),and was always at a high level. [Conclusion] Different immune combinations of CSF,HP-PRRS and FMD vaccine may cause different immune responses to swine,and the changes of cytokines throughout the immune process were not simply rising and falling,but a relatively complex dynamic change process.
